Synopsis:

The story of 5 friends growing tired of everyday life....

On a quest to see "Star Wars Episode I" they run out of gas.
Getting "Lost in the Wilderness" they find that the game of survival is much harder than they thought as they encounter an exploding chicken, poison ivy, starvation, rotten pizza hallucinations, thirst, mushroom induced illusions, and a hunter.

They must do anything in their power to survive, even fight each other in despair, drink their own fluids and cannibalism

Full Story:

Most people don't like change but they hate the everyday routine that is life, we all get up in the morning and have a routine, we eat, work, go to school, come home, eat, sleep, Entertain ourselves (not in that particular order) and do it all over again every day.

This story of five friends Jack, Justin, Dwight, Georges and Jason growing tired of everyday life, takes place in St Petersburg Florida, a flat and boring place where this young group of pals start noticing their cycle has no end and there is no light at the end of their tunnel other than taking short little mind vacations walking around Downtown, going to see movies or hiding in the shadows of their favorite movie icons like the star of the Chinese fighting movies "Kitt Lee" and Porn Star "Woodgirl".

   
  Until Producer Director George Lucas Releases the twenty-year long anticipated "Star Wars: Episode I - The Phantom Menace" on May 19, 1999.

Finally something to look forward to and with the excitement some leave their depressing environments, they leave the comforts of their homes, Georges's girlfriend leaves him and Justin quits his job.

They start a quest to see "Star Wars: Episode I - The Phantom Menace" but they know this event only comes one time in their life they will be a part of history since the last time when the first three movies where released "Star Wars Episode IV A New Hope" in 1977, "Star Wars Episode V The Empire Strikes Back" in 1980 and "Star Wars Episode VI Return of the Jedi" in 1983 when people stood in line and camped out for weeks in advance just to see these epics.

Now they where going to do the same thing in their generation with "Star Wars Episode I - The Phantom Menace" 1999 and they where planning to do the same thing for the other 2 prequels, "Star Wars Episode II Attack of the Clones", in 2002 and "Star Wars Episode III in 2005 but what was to come they would never expect and they where not aware that most of them wouldn't even get to see the movie at all.

For this glorious occasion the guys buy 6 tickets for each of them, meaning they would see all six showings of the movie the first day and they would travel to the furthest reaches of their town to see the film in their favorite theatre not just any theatre but the AMC Theatre where Stadium Seating reaches as far as the eye can see.

On the way to the theatre Jack Picks up all his friends and being late enough as it is, they take a life changing shortcut through the woods, but half way there they run out of gas.

Now they must decide to go up or down the road and go around the woods or go through them.

Getting "Lost in the Wilderness" they find that the game of survival is much harder than they thought

They leave a trail of Alkazeltsers behind to find their way back in case they get lost, but a chicken follows close behind eating their trail and as they go deeper into the woods they encounter the now foaming at the mouth exploding chicken, rotten pizza hallucinations of their Favorite Movie Icons, poison ivy, starvation, thirst, and mushroom induced illusions.

Now they must do anything in their power to survive the harsh Florida Summer Environments and each other.

They try to retain sanity but patience and tolerance runs dry as they fight each other in despair, drink their own Urine and even sink to cannibalism as they eat their friend Jason who is the only one who in four months in the Wilderness has not lost a pound but gained weight dramatically with a backpack secretly filled with all kinds of food.

 

Finally they separate and Dwight goes off on his own leaving Jack, Justin and Georges behind finding the road and the car by him self and suddenly the unexpected tragedy, Dwight gets hit and run over by a Klansman driving an "El Camino", and gets taken to the Hospital where he finds no help and dies before he can speak about his lost friends.

 

Georges walking with Jack and Justin suddenly gets a case of "Wilderness Fever" and before he goes mad, he suddenly gets shot by a Crazy Half Blind Deer Hunter.

 

Now Jack and Justin must run for their lives and in the middle of all that chaos, in the distance, away from the woods they find the AMC Theatres, and they finally get the answers to their prayers.
